Three Lufkin Panthers received first-team recognition with the release of the 14-5A all-district baseball team as voted by the league's coaches.

Left-handed pitcher Tyler Stubblefield, who signed with Texas A&M last November, was a unanimous selection at first-team pitcher. Only seven of the first team's 15 players were unanimous picks.

Lufkin's Cort McPherson and Gunner Quick joined Stubblefield on the first team. McPherson, a junior during the 2013 season, made the squad at first base, while Quick, a senior, was selected at shortstop.

The Woodlands senior Ryan Burnett and sophomore Chris Andritsos shared Most Valuable Player honors, while the Highlanders' coach Ron Eastman was named Coach of the Year. Eastman led The Woodlands to the 14-5A title before the Highlanders won the Class 5A state championship.

Bryan freshman Landon Miner was named Newcomer of the Year.
